## Formula sandbox tuning

User-supplied formulas in Gridmoor execute inside a restricted interpreter with hard ceilings on time, memory, and call depth. Reviewers should confirm any change to these ceilings is justified in the PR description, since raising them widens the abuse surface. Defaults were chosen from production traces. The current limits are as follows.

limits module of tafog-fawip:
WEIGHTS = {
    "julix": 57,
    "lamys": 992,
    "kasvan": 209,
    "quenok": 750,
    "alddor": 259,
    "oliath": 1009,
    "wenix": 815,
}

v3.8.0 — Changed defaults for Socketry's websocket layer. Per-message deflate is now off by default: compression saved roughly 30% bandwidth on chatty channels but cost us CPU spikes and memory fragmentation under the Harrowfield load profile, and two paging incidents traced back to context takeover. Teams that want compression must opt in per channel. If you get paged for bandwidth alarms after this rollout, check whether the tenant opted in before escalating. The new shipped defaults are listed below.

settings of bahop-kaweg:
[novael]
host = novael.braskstack.example
user = novael_svc
database = novael_prod

If your plugin loses access to the Marrowgate tax-rate lookup cache, do not rebuild it from scratch. The cache account in the Velsten portal can be recovered in place, preserving your warmed entries. First, confirm the plugin's service account shows as suspended, not deleted. Suspended accounts recover within minutes; deleted ones require a support escalation to the Orvane team. Initiate recovery from the plugin settings page and choose "restore cache credentials." When prompted, supply the recovery passphrase shown directly below.

vault phrase of tajeg-tageg = pelix-druix-holius-briael-zorwyn-frawyn-fraox-norok-drueth-aldiel

Pinning policy for Bramblewire releases: all third-party packages are pinned to exact versions in the lockfile, refreshed on a fixed cadence rather than ad hoc. The release manager approves any off-cycle bump with a one-line justification. Transitive overrides expire automatically. The cadence windows, grace periods, and override limits are defined by the following constants.

constants for tafog-kahag:
RATE_LIMITS = {
    "sorir": 697,
    "oliox": 683,
    "holax": 176,
    "casox": 60,
    "pelius": 382,
}